debug是什么意思及常用的debug方法介绍
Debug是什么意思及常用的Debug方法介绍
在软件开发过程中,Debug是一项非常重要的工作。它是指在程序运行过程中发现并修复程序中的错误或缺陷,Debug是一项非常繁琐的工作,需要程序员有一定的技巧和经验。本文将介绍Debug的含义和常用的Debug方法。
一、Debug的含义
Debug是源于英文单词“debugging”的缩写,它的含义是除错。在软件开发过程中,Debug是指在程序运行过程中发现并修复程序中的错误或缺陷,Debug是一项非常繁琐的工作,需要程序员有一定的技巧和经验。
二、常用的Debug方法
1. 打印调试信息
打印调试信息是Debug中常用的方法之一。程序员可以在程序中插入一些特殊的代码,用来输出程序运行过程中的一些信息。这些信息可以帮助程序员了解程序的运行状态,
2. 断点调试
断点调试是Debug中另一个非常常用的方法。程序员可以在程序中设置断点,当程序运行到断点处时,程序会停止运行,程序员可以查看程序运行状态,
3. 单步调试
单步调试是Debug中另一个非常重要的方法。程序员可以在程序中设置单步调试模式,当程序运行到单步调试模式时,程序会停止运行,程序员可以逐行查看程序运行状态,
4. 远程调试
远程调试是Debug中另一个非常重要的方法。程序员可以通过网络连接远程调试工具,来对远程计算机上的程序进行调试。这种方法非常适合需要在远程计算机上进行调试的场景。
5. 测试驱动开发
测试驱动开发是Debug中另一个非常重要的方法。它是一种软件开发方法论,它强调先编写测试用例,再编写程序。通过测试用例,程序员可以更容易地发现程序中的错误。
Debug是软件开发过程中非常重要的一环。它可以帮助程序员发现并修复程序中的错误或缺陷,本文介绍了Debug的含义和常用的Debug方法,包括打印调试信息、断点调试、单步调试、远程调试和测试驱动开发。希望本文可以帮助读者更好地了解Debug的含义和常用的Debug方法。